My jaw dropped when this bike club rode in with this bike in the lead. 
The rider  weighed in at 450 ad his vest said Tiny. ( Of Course )
They parked next to our pit and I took these pictures, I'm sure they thought I liked the bike but I was taking the pictures as a OH MY GOD moment .
Fork tubes were doubled in length by screwing two tubes together and then welding them into one piece. 
Stress crack went all the way around the tubes. The deflection of the tubes was crazy while being ridden
